Amy Hanifan said one of the biggest challenges women in firefighting will face is the balancing act of work, "to provide a service but also the task of making it a better work space for those we work with now, and for those coming up behind."
Humboldt Bay Fire quoted Hanifan, the Operations Chief of McMinnville Fire Department in Oregon and President of Women in Fire, on Facebook Thursday in honor of Women's History Month. HBF said it believes they shoulder that burden.
"We at HBF believe this challenge falls on us all," they said in the post. "And we are proud to celebrate and support our sisters in the fire service."
According to HBF 4% of all career firefighters are women, 11% of volunteer firefighters are women and 12% of federal wildland firefighters are women.
